Installer Java (Oracle) sur la Debian 7.0 Wheezy

Debian ne fourni plus les paquets oracle-java (JRE et JDK) et conseille l’installation d’OpenJDK à la place. Cependant il peut arriver que certaines applications demandent une version exacte de java, voir même imposent la JRE Oracle.

Publié le

En fait c’est assez simple à faire : il faut télécharger la VM Oracle de son choix, la packager en un fichier DEB, et l’installer.

Télécharger les binaires Oracle

Sur le site d’Oracle bien sur : http://www.oracle.com/technetwork/java/javase/downloads/index.html

Bien choisir la version -linux-x64.bin ou tar.gz et non pas la version RPM.

Créer le package

En root,

apt-get install java-package

Puis passer en utilisateur non root (par sécurité disent t’ils…)

fakeroot make-jpkg jre-XuXX-linux-x64.tar.gz

Remplacez jre-XuXX-linux-x64.tar.gz par le fichier téléchargé depuis le site d’Oracle, à packager.

Installez le

Puis repasser en root, pour installer le deb qu’il vous aura créé :

dpkg -i oracle-j2re1.X_1.X.0+updateXX_amd64.deb

Utilisez update-alternatives pour basculer sur votre nouvelle VM si besoin.

Je vous ai épargné tout ce qui est copie de fichier…

Plus d’information sur le wiki de Debian.